# Runbook: Hunting leaked file descriptors in Quillgate

When the `fd_open` gauge climbs steadily between deploys, suspect a leak rather than load. First confirm on a single pod: exec in and count entries under `/proc/1/fd`, noting how many are sockets in CLOSE_WAIT versus regular files. Capture two snapshots ten minutes apart before restarting anything — we need the delta for the postmortem. Reproduce locally with the Marbury load harness, which requires the service running with the following configuration values.

settings of yagep-bajog:
[istdor]
port = 4000
region = south-2
host = istdor.qorvelcorp.internal
timeout_ms = 5000
retries = 5

// Assignment service tuning for the Larkspell experiment platform.
// Bucketing is deterministic per user hash, so these constants mostly
// govern cache behavior and exposure logging, not assignment itself.
// Shortening the cache TTL increases config-store load; lengthening it
// delays flag rollouts. The exposure batch size trades log latency
// against write amplification. Do not change salts — that reshuffles
// every running experiment. Current production values follow.

tuning constants:
TIERS = {
    "silys": 464,
    "beldor": 976,
    "fraion": 68,
    "fenath": 281,
    "novvan": 333,
    "zordor": 202,
    "kasix": 219,
}

### Runbook: Report export timezone mismatches (Glimmerfield)

If a customer reports that exported totals differ from the dashboard, check whether their report schedule predates the March cutover — older schedules still render in server-local time rather than the account timezone. Re-saving the schedule fixes it. Before escalating, confirm the export worker is running with the expected timezone settings shown below.

config for kadup-kajog:
[raldor]
host = raldor.tolvaqworks.internal
user = raldor_svc
database = raldor_prod